Transverse momenta of hadrons in inclusive reactions in the quark-gluon string model

In the framework of the quark-gluon string model we propose a mechanism of taking into account the dependence of the distribution functions of quarks, diquarks, and of their fragmentation into hadrons on the transverse momentum {ital k}{sub {perpendicular}}. We assume the successive distribution of {ital k}{sub {perpendicular}} among 2{ital n}-quark-antiquark chains (or {ital n}-pomeron showers). We analyze hadron and hadron-nucleus processes: we calculate the {ital x} dependence of the average transverse momentum of pions in {ital pp} collisions and the inclusive spectra of hadrons in {ital pA} interactions at fixed and at different transverse momenta of the hadrons. In this approach we obtain a strong dependence of the observable quantities on the number {ital n}, which is especially important in analyzing hadron-nucleus collisions.
